Georgia Southwestern’s Late Game Comeback Shocks Columbus State Baseball with Explosive Scoring
Georgia Southwestern State University's late-game comeback defeats Columbus State University baseball team in a close match, with the Cougars falling 8-11, bringing their record to 27-16 (13-8 PBC) while the Hurricanes improve to 29-13. Both teams engaged in a back-and-forth battle in the first three innings until GSW seized the lead in the seventh and eighth innings through a series of scoring plays.
